How Do You Do NFT for Digital Art?

Art|Digital Art

Creating non-fungible tokens (NFTs) for digital art is becoming a popular way for artist to monetize their work. With the emergence of blockchain technology and the ability to securely store and transfer digital assets, more and more artists are turning to NFTs as a means of monetizing their art. But how does one go about creating an NFT for their digital art?

The first step in creating an NFT for your digital art is to make sure you have a platform that supports the creation and sale of NFTs. Most platforms that allow users to create and trade digital assets, such as CryptoKitties or CryptoPunks, also offer NFT creation tools. These tools provide a simple interface that allows users to create an NFT from any image they have uploaded or own the rights to.

Once you have chosen a platform that supports NFT creation, you will need to upload your artwork to the platform. This can be done by either uploading a file directly from your computer or using an external image hosting service like Imgur or Dropbox. Once your artwork has been uploaded, you will need to set up the details of your NFT, such as its name, description, and associated metadata.

Once you have created your NFT on the platform of your choice, it’s time to start marketing it! You can do this by sharing it on social media sites like Twitter or Instagram with hashtags related to your artwork or even running Targeted advertising campaigns on platforms like Google Ads or Facebook Ads.

Finally, once you have marketed your artwork sufficiently, it’s time to put it up for sale! You can do this by setting up an auction on the platform where you created your NFT or listing it on marketplaces like OpenSea or SuperRare. Once someone has purchased your artwork in the form of an NFT, they will receive a token that can be stored in their wallet and transferred freely between wallets.
